Is fill dirt cheaper than topsoil in Bay Pines, FL?

Yes. In Bay Pines and West Florida, fill dirt is generally less expensive than topsoil because it contains little to no organic matter and is used mainly for raising grade or filling holes. If you need planting or lawn topsoil on top of the fill, budget for additional topsoil or compost.

What does one cubic yard of fill dirt look like?

One cubic yard is a 3 ft x 3 ft x 3 ft cube — about the size of a large washing machine or a small compact car trunk. For visual planning, a single cubic yard will cover about 9 square feet at 4 inches deep.

What is fill dirt in Florida and how is Bay Pines fill dirt different?

Fill dirt in Florida is typically sandy with minimal organic material and may include small shell fragments or clay lenses. In Bay Pines, expect lighter, sandier fill than inland areas, so it drains quickly but compacts less naturally than clay-rich fill.

How can I fix a sandy yard in Bay Pines using fill dirt?

Use fill dirt to regrade low spots or raise soil level, then cover it with 4-6 inches of quality topsoil mixed with compost for planting. For lawns and gardens in Bay Pines, improving sandy yards also requires adding organic matter and frequent top-dressing over time to build fertility and moisture retention.

Can I use fill dirt to level my backyard in Bay Pines?

Yes — fill dirt is commonly used to build up low areas and establish proper drainage before landscaping. After bringing in fill dirt, compact it in layers and finish with several inches of topsoil if you plan to plant grass or a garden.

Will one cubic yard of fill dirt fit in a pickup truck?

Most full-size pickup beds can safely carry about 0.5 to 1 cubic yard of loose fill dirt, but weight is the limiting factor. Because fill dirt can be heavy, check your truck's payload capacity before hauling; for larger jobs in Bay Pines, ordering bulk delivery from Hello Gravel is usually easier and safer.

How many 40 lb bags of soil equal one cubic yard of fill dirt?

A rough rule is 50 to 70 40-lb bags per cubic yard, depending on material density. For Bay Pines’ sandy fill dirt you can expect toward the lower end of that range, but buying bulk by the yard is more cost-effective for most projects.

How do I spread fill dirt properly on my property?

Spread fill dirt in thin layers (4-6 inches), lightly water each layer if dry, and compact each lift with a plate compactor or hand tamp to reduce future settling. Request tailgate spreading at checkout if you want the driver to offload close to the target area, but remember the driver will assess feasibility on arrival.

Can I put new fill dirt on top of old soil in Bay Pines?

Yes, you can place fill dirt over existing soil to raise grade, but mix or cap it with topsoil if you plan to grow plants. Also check for buried utilities, and if you are changing elevations near property lines or drainage paths, confirm local codes.

Is 2 inches of topsoil enough after placing fill dirt to grow grass in Bay Pines?

No — for establishing a healthy lawn in Bay Pines you should aim for 4 to 6 inches of quality topsoil over the fill dirt. Fill dirt is fine for structural grade but usually lacks the organic matter needed for seed or sod to thrive.

What is the 70/30 rule and does it apply to using fill dirt in gardening?

The 70/30 rule often means mixing about 70% native soil (or fill dirt) with 30% compost or organic amendment to improve planting beds. In Bay Pines, where native soils are sandy, follow this or similar amendment ratios for new garden beds, but use pure topsoil or amended mixes for lawns and high-value plantings.

Do I need a permit to bring in fill dirt in Bay Pines?

Small residential deliveries for yard leveling normally do not require a permit, but larger fills, work in flood zones, or changes affecting drainage or wetlands may be regulated. Check with Bay Pines or Pinellas County planning and floodplain officials before major grading or when working near protected areas.

How can I turn Bay Pines sand into better soil naturally?

Add generous amounts of organic matter such as compost, mulch, and well-rotted manure and top-dress annually to build structure and water-holding capacity. Over time, planting cover crops and practicing regular top-dressing will gradually improve sandy soils more sustainably than fill dirt alone.
